★★★★★ 5.0 Jeff Bailey · Sep 2024

What a wonderful little park! We stayed 2 nights in electric rv site while passing through. It's very peaceful here. There is an area for equestrian camping, horse trails, a boat ramp, lots of nice-looking fishing coves, a couple of fishing piers, and a cleaning station. Restrooms and showers are very clean and well maintained. Every few hours a park Ranger would drive through, which is a pleasant reassurance. If we're back in the area, we will definitely stay again!

★★★★★ 5.0 Amber Kresha · Sep 2021

We had a great time here! Camped in a tent at spot #97 and #98. The site was little small, so we had to park along the road. Not many campers in this side of the park so it was quiet. The loop with the RVs was packed! The equine trail head was right next to our site, so the kids were happy to see an occasional horse. We could occasionally hear a horse from the horse corrals which are nearby. Site #97 did not have a cooking grate on the fire ring, #98 did. Both sites were partial shade and had picnic tables. We walked around and this park is beautiful! There's a picnic area (one table) down on the lake where we took some nice photos. The beach was nice and clean and the kids had a blast there. We wished there was somewhere to rent kayaks or paddle boats. Overall, we had fun and would come
